Bonjour — CompTIA A+ Core 1 (220-1101) Practice Questions

Bonjour is Apple's implementation of zero-configuration networking and is built on mDNS and DNS Service Discovery protocols. It allows Apple and compatible devices to automatically find printers, file shares, and other services on the local network without manual configuration. The 220-1101 exam mentions Bonjour in the context of printer discovery and cross-platform interoperability, since many network printers and Windows systems also support it. Technicians supporting mixed environments or Apple devices should understand how Bonjour traffic behaves and what firewall or network segmentation issues can prevent it from functioning.
